Vulnerability details
The vulnerability allows a local user to perform a denial of service (DoS) attack.
The vulnerability exists due to improper conditions check in the voltage modulation interface for some Intel(R) Xeon(R) Scalable Processors. A local user can perform a denial of service attack.
The following Intel Xeon Scalable Processors are affected:
- Intel Xeon Platinum Processors: 8153, 8156, 8158, 8160, 8160F, 8160M, 8160T, 8164, 8168, 8170, 8170M, 8176, 8176F, 8176M, 8180, 8180M
- Intel
Xeon Gold Processors: 5115, 5118, 5119T, 5120, 5120T, 5122, 6126,
6126F, 6126T, 6128, 6130, 6130F, 6130T, 6132, 6134, 6134M, 6136, 6138,
6138F, 6138T, 6140, 6140M, 6142, 6142F, 6142M, 6144, 6146, 6148, 6148F,
6150, 6152, 6154
- Intel Xeon Silver Processors: 4108, 4109T, 4110, 4112, 4114, 4114T, 4116, 4116T
- Intel Xeon Bronze Processors: 3104, 3106

How to mitigate CVE-2019-11139
Install firmware updates from your manufacturer's website.
intel-microcode (Ubuntu package) - addressed in versions 3.20191115.1ubuntu0.14.04.2, 3.20191115.1ubuntu0.16.04.2, 3.20191115.1ubuntu0.18.04.2, 3.20191115.1ubuntu0.19.04.2, 3.20191115.1ubuntu0.19.10.2
microcode_ctl - addressed in versions 2.1-33.fc29, 2.1-33.fc31
microcode_ctl (Red Hat package) - addressed in versions 2.1-53.3.el7_7, 20190618-1.20191112.1.el8_1
kernel - addressed in versions 5.3.11-100.fc29, 5.3.11-300.fc31
kernel-headers - addressed in versions 5.3.11-100.fc29, 5.3.11-300.fc31
kernel-tools - addressed in versions 5.3.11-100.fc29, 5.3.11-300.fc31
